Fix tunnel script overwriting credentials for existing tunnels
When an existing Cloudflare tunnel was found, the script would overwrite the credentials file with an empty TunnelSecret, breaking the service. Now validates existing credentials and only recreates the tunnel if the credentials file is missing or invalid.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>
